Solomon’s teachings on adultery are solid. It does seem rather odd that a man with a thousand wives would talk about a young man being seduced by a prostitute {Proverbs 7}. There are consequences to sleeping with a prostitute but there are also consequences to being a polygamist. I guess Solomon justified his position by claiming that his wives were not prostitutes. Adultery is adultery. It seldom involves a prostitute. Solomon said in Ecclesiastes 7:28, “Only one out of a thousand men is virtuous, but not one woman!” I think Solomon was down on women and I think he had a love/hate relationship with his own mother, but I do admit that it is total conjecture. He does suggest in all his writings that men are victims to the females seduction and charms. Whereas it is true that women control their passions much better than men and can use them at will to get what they want, they are not always the agressors. Women seduce, men rape: which is more vile? I think we are all equally guilty.
The one thing that should help us avoid the pitfall of adultery is the fear of the consequences: you will destroy your own life. Some translation read, destroy your own soul. There is no sin without consequence but adultery’s consquences are greater than most. Only fools ignore consequences. We have all seen both men and women jump the fence looking for a greener pasture. Several years into their new relationship, they are miserable. Oh they appear to be happy on the outside. They go the extra mile to convince everyone around them that they are happy, but they are not. Deep down they are grieving because they have destroyed something that can never recover.
